Chain Link Fencing Benefits

Chain link fencing offers a practical solution for companies looking for security and visibility. The open design offers unobstructed visibility, allowing for easy monitoring of the property. This fencing option is exceptionally durable, made from galvanized steel that withstands rust and corrosion, ensuring long-lasting performance. Furthermore, chain link fences are cost-effective, making them an attractive option for companies working within tight budgets. Installation is relatively straightforward, helping to minimize labor costs and installation time. Beyond that, chain link fences can be tailored with different heights and finishes to meet particular requirements. This versatility allows businesses to preserve a secure space while meeting aesthetic requirements. In summary, chain link fencing offers a balanced combination of security, functionality, and affordability for commercial properties.

Vinyl Fence Durability Characteristics

Vinyl fencing is renowned for its exceptional durability, making it a preferred choice for many commercial properties. Unlike wood, vinyl does not warp, crack, or splinter, providing a long-lasting barrier capable of withstanding various weather conditions. This material is resistant to pests and decay, removing the need for frequent maintenance or replacement. In addition, vinyl fencing is UV resistant, preventing fading and discoloration over time. Its robust construction allows it to endure impacts without significant damage, upholding its structural integrity. Many commercial property owners appreciate the ease of cleaning vinyl, as it can be simply washed down with soap and water. Ultimately, vinyl fencing delivers a reliable, low-maintenance solution that addresses the demands of commercial environments.

Selecting the Ideal Fencing: Essential Considerations

How can a business determine the most suitable fencing solution for its needs? Initially, it is important to examine the unique demands of the property, including the necessary level of protection. Locations with heightened security demands may require choices such as chain-link or barbed wire fencing, while design considerations might favor decorative metal or wooden fences.

Furthermore, companies ought to examine the surrounding climate and ecological factors, as they may affect the longevity of fence materials. To illustrate, seaside locations often need corrosion-resistant fencing materials.

Budget constraints also play an important role; businesses must balance initial costs with long-term maintenance expenses.

In addition, zoning regulations and property lines should be evaluated to verify compliance. By evaluating these factors, businesses can select a fencing solution that not only addresses security requirements but also corresponds to their business and budgetary goals.

Overview of Installation Costs

Installation fees have a considerable impact in the overall budget for commercial fencing installations. These fees can differ considerably based on several factors, including the type of fencing, the dimensions of the area to be fenced, and area labor charges. In most cases, organizations should budget for site preparation, which may include removing debris or grading the terrain. Moreover, the intricacy of the project—such as incorporating gates or specialized designs—can additionally affect expenses. Typically speaking, businesses can anticipate spending between $5 to $15 per linear foot for installation, subject to these considerations. Organizations should seek multiple quotes from contractors to secure the best available context information pricing and to plan for unanticipated charges that may emerge during the project.

Key Maintenance Tips for Long-Lasting Fence Solutions

Despite the fact that many disregard the critical nature of regular upkeep, proper maintenance is crucial for preserving the lifespan and strength of professional fencing structures. Periodic evaluations should be performed to recognize evidence of degradation or defects, including rust, rot, or loose fittings. Swift remediation can prevent further deterioration and costly replacements.

Washing the fence regularly is also important; removing dirt, debris, and plant growth can help prevent corrosion and decay. For wooden fences, using a weather-resistant sealant every several years can shield from dampness and insects. Metallic fences benefit from a rust-resistant coating to prevent rust.

Furthermore, maintaining proper drainage surrounding the fence ensures that water does not collect, which can weaken the fencing over time. By applying these maintenance tips, organizations can enhance the longevity of their fencing, confirming that it maintains protection and visual appeal for years to come.

Choosing the Best Fencing Contractor for Your Business

How can a business make certain it hires the best fencing contractor? The process begins with thorough research. Organizations should search for contractors with a well-established reputation, validated through customer feedback and testimonials. It is vital to check for proper licensing and insurance to confirm compliance with local regulations and to mitigate liability risks.

Moreover, gathering multiple bids can shed light on current market rates and offerings. A comprehensive estimate should include materials, project timelines, and warranty information, permitting businesses to assess their options with confidence. Communication is essential; contractors ought to display responsiveness and a willingness to address questions.

In addition, evaluating past projects can showcase the contractor's knowledge and workmanship. Companies might also explore nearby contractors who are familiar with local regulations and conditions. In the end, taking these steps can result in a trustworthy business relationship that assures the fence solution fulfills the distinct needs of the organization.

What Is the Typical Duration of Commercial Fencing Installation?

Commercial fencing installation typically takes between one and three days, subject to factors like the materials used, the scope of the project, and required permits. Weather conditions can also influence the timeline considerably.

Are Commercial Fencing Projects Subject to Zoning Laws?

That is correct, local zoning regulations regularly govern commercial fence installations, as codes can determine materials, height, and placement. Business owners need to check local ordinances to secure proper compliance and avoid potential fines or required modifications after installation.

Which Materials Offer the Greatest Durability for Commercial Fencing?

Steel and vinyl are among the most durable materials for commercial fencing. Steel offers strength and longevity, while vinyl provides weather resistance and low maintenance. Both options guarantee reliable security for various commercial properties.
